Zimbabwe: Airzim Files U.S.$ 8.5 Million Pig Lawsuit
Thursday November 01st 2012, 5:29 am Filed under Accident lawsuit

[The Herald]AIR Zimbabwe is suing the Civil Aviation Authority of Zimbabwe for over US$8,5 million for damages after its plane collided with wild pigs on the runway three years ago. The airline's MA60 aircraft collided with the pigs at the Harare International Airport runway in November 2009 as it prepared to take off resulting in the flight from Harare to Bulawayo being cancelled.
